AkknaTek Reduces Refractive Surprises After Cataract Surgery

AkknaTek’s Lens Reviewer helps eye surgeons ensure safe, accurate lens positioning and makes postoperative management of dislocated intraocular lens (IOLs) more intuitive and straightforward.
ExPrimary Makes Bioanalytical Tools More Accessible

ExPrimary is miniaturizing and reducing the costs of bioanalytical instrumentation to advance personalized healthcare and shift disease management from reactive to preventative.
Haqean Fights Drug Counterfeiting with Quantum Randomness

Haqean’s SID-Q anti-counterfeiting solution helps pharma manufacturers and hospitals to ensure product safety and efficiency.
Kilo Medical Solutions Improves NICU Light Conditions

Kilo Medical Solutions’ Brise-Solette can be applied to incubators to mimic the light and sound of the womb and alert nurses when care is needed while collecting data for improved treatment.
Nordetect Helps Farmers Speed Soil Testing and Optimize Fertilizer Use

Nordetect’s lab-on-a-chip device and test kit reduce soil testing time from days to minutes, driving faster decisions that impact crop yield and input cost while mitigating environmental pollution.
Rubitection Saves Lives with Early Bedsore Detection

Rubitection’s handheld optical probe and mobile app help care providers detect and monitor bedsores before they become deadly, with implications for the broader skin health market.
SaNoor Enables the Internet of Underwater Things

SaNoor’s laser LiFi solutions overcome the challenges of underwater settings to provide reliable wireless data transmission beyond 10 Gb/s.
Simulated Inanimate Models Makes Surgical Training Risk-Free

Simulated Inanimate Models (SIM) combines lifelike hydrogel models with educational software and AR to give surgeons immersive training without risks to patients.
SunDensity Enhances the Energy Output of Solar Panels

SunDensity’s Photonic Smart Coating (PSC) technology increases the energy efficiency of opto-electronic devices such as solar panels and architectural glass.
Think Outside Reveals Key Data About What’s Beneath the Snow

Think Outside’s durable, lightweight Sknow sensors use radar technology to inform the hydropower industry of the true water potential of the snow in the mountains.
COHORT 2:January-June 2019
Augmentiqs Transforms Microscopes into Smart, Connected Devices

Augmentiqs evolutionizes the microscope with an electro-optical module that retrofits into existing microscopes, facilitating augmented reality of the eyepiece and live-image capture of tissue samples.
Circle Optics Eliminates Stitching for 360 Video in 12K

Circle Optics has completely eliminated stitching (the process of aligning multiple images pixel-by-pixel to create a unified image) through a revolutionary camera design, enabling shareable, immersive, real-time experiences.
Efferent Labs Implantable Biosensors for Real-Time Monitoring

Efferent Labs’ biosensor system transmits live data through the cloud to data acquisition and analysis software, providing real-time information to researchers and clinicians.
Lumedica Vision Makes it Easy to Diagnose Retina Disease

Lumedica creates affordable scientific and medical instruments for diagnosing retina disease that are easier to acquire, transport, and use in optometry offices and field clinic settings all over the world.
Mango teQ Transforms Ride Experience for Motorcyclists with REYEDER

REYEDR, a helmet-mounted heads-up display (HUD) from Mango teQ, uses holographic technology to create a virtual display within the rider’s immediate field of view.
Neurescense Images Individual Brain Cells Firing in Real Time

Neurescence enables unprecedented understanding of brain disease mechanisms and the effect of drugs on the formation of neuronal circuits and their relation to task performance.
Opalux Protects Identification with Tamper-Proof Personalized Holograms

Opalux has developed an innovative security feature that permanently engraves an individual’s portrait and personal data inside a color-shifting hologram that is impossible to counterfeit.
Organic Robotics Corporation Tests Artificial Skin for Smart Garments and Robots

Organic Robotics Corporation has developed a stretchable smart material that can sense its own shape and measure surface pressure, giving robots a sense of touch for a variety of commercial applications.
Ovitz Provides Individialized Vision Correction with Custom Contact Lenses

Ovitz captures over 64 unique data points to characterize a patient’s visual function with high accuracy, providing individualized vision correction not possible with other methods available today.
VPG Medical’s HealthKam Enables Effortless, Seamless Cardiac Monitoring Using Smart Devices

VPG Medical’s HealthKam leverages smart device connectivity to provide cloud analytics and feedback to healthcare professionals, improving cardiac diagnoses and therapeutic strategies.
